From the Northwestern Wildcats, we've got incredible performances in the past month from Nick Martinelli and Ty Berry. Martinelli’s been impressive, putting up 20.7 points and 7.1 rebounds per game on a consistent basis. Berry's no slouch either, with 16.3 points and 4.7 rebounds per game. These two have been carrying the Wildcats on their back, like some sort of basketball-playing Atlas.
On the other side of the court, we've got the Maryland Terrapins flaunting their impressive roster with the likes of Derik Queen and JaKobi Gillespie. Queen's been a monster on the court, dominating with 18.4 points and 11.5 rebounds per game. Gillespie's followed suit with 15.4 points and 5.0 assists per game.
